Federal authorities are investigating Detroit Pistons guard Malik Beasley on allegations of gambling related to NBA games and prop bets, sources told ESPN on Sunday.
Beasley averaged 11.3 points in 79 games that season, during which he made a career-high 77 starts.
The Pistons told ESPN on Sunday that they are aware of an investigation into Beasley and are deferring further comment to the NBA.
"We are cooperating with the federal prosecutors' investigation," NBA spokesman Mike Bass told ESPN.
The nine-year veteran averaged 16.3 points while appearing in all 82 games last season, his first with the Pistons.
